A police complaint has been filed against Rashtriya Swayamsewak Sangh (RSS) general secretary Dattatreya Hosabale, accusing him of making "unconstitutional, inflammatory and divisive" comments and seeking legal action against him.

- Arun Dev

BENGALURU:

The complaint, filed by members of the Karnataka legal cell of the Indian Youth Congress, said that Hosabale's recent comments seeking to remove the terms "socialist" and "secular" from the Preamble of the Indian Constitution were an "attack on the constitutional ethos" and an "incitement against the nation's founding values".
